Legal Issues with Cracked Software

The primary issue with cracked software is that it is illegal and violates copyright laws. Distributing or using pirated software can lead to legal troubles, including fines and even criminal charges. Many companies, including Microsoft, actively pursue individuals who are caught using unauthorized software. The legal risks are real and should not be ignored.

Security Risks of Cracked Software

Cracked software often comes packaged with malware or viruses. When you install a cracked version of Microsoft Office, you are essentially downloading a potential threat to your computer. These viruses can steal personal information, compromise your system, and even lead to data loss. It’s best to avoid installing software from unknown sources to ensure your system's security.

Lack of Updates and Support

One of the significant drawbacks of using cracked software is that it does not receive official updates or patches. Cracked versions lag behind in terms of security and functionality upgrades. This means you are left vulnerable to security holes and bugs that can be easily patched in legitimate versions. Additionally, if you encounter any issues, you won’t have access to support from Microsoft or official technical help. This can make troubleshooting and problem-solving much more difficult.

Safe and Legal Alternatives

Instead of using cracked software, there are safer and legitimate alternatives available. For instance, LibreOffice and OnlyOffice Desktop Editors are both excellent office suites that offer similar functionality to Microsoft Office without any of the associated risks. These free and open-source solutions are fully compatible with Microsoft Office files, making them a reliable choice for most users.

LibreOffice is a powerful and free alternative to Microsoft Office. It offers a wide range of features and is compatible with most file formats used by Microsoft Office. OnlyOffice Desktop Editors, another free and open-source alternative, provides a similar experience and is also compatible with Microsoft Office formats. Both options are safe to use and ensure compliance with legal standards.
